Sharon Mckay

Sharon McKay is a respected author known for her contributions to children's literature and young adult fiction, often focusing on challenging and poignant themes. Her work frequently addresses issues of social justice, conflict, and human rights, drawing from historical events and personal stories to create engaging and thought-provoking narratives.

As a writer, Sharon is committed to telling stories that not only entertain but also educate and empower her readers. She has a talent for bringing complex characters to life, exploring their struggles and triumphs in a way that resonates with young audiences. Her books are used in schools across various countries, serving as tools for education and discussion on important topics.

Beyond her writing, Sharon is actively involved in the literary community, participating in workshops, school visits, and speaking engagements. Her dedication to her craft and her ability to address tough topics with sensitivity and insight have made her a beloved figure among readers and educators alike.
